    Levamisole-Adulterated Cocaine Induced Skin Necrosis of Nose, Ears, and Extremities: Case Report

    Levamisole is an immunomodulatory and antihelminthic drug, previously removed from the United States market, and now estimated to be present in the vast majority of cocaine distributed in the United States. Levamisole-adulterated cocaine (LAC) exposure can result in neutropenia, thrombocytopenia, and vasculitis with a predilection for subsites of the face. The objective of this review is to increase awareness among otolaryngologists of the manifestations of LAC exposure. We present the case of a 33-year-old woman with a history of cocaine use, consulted for purpuric, necrotic lesions of the nose, cheeks, and ears, with accompanying leukopenia, thrombocytopenia, and positive antineutrophil cytoplasmic antibodies (ANCA). The effects of levamisole are immune mediated, with antibodies directed against neutrophils causing neutropenia, and vasculitis caused by antibody deposition or secondary to induction of antiphospholipid antibodies causing thrombosis. LAC exposure can be differentiated from other similar appearing pathologies by evaluating serology for specific ANCA. The most important treatment is cessation of cocaine use, which most often results in complete resolution of symptoms. Awareness of the presentation, complications, and treatment of LAC exposure may be especially important for otolaryngologists, who may be one of the firsts to evaluate an affected patient

    Fibrosarcomas of the Paranasal Sinuses: A Systematic Review

    Fibrosarcomas are rare, malignant neoplasms of mesenchymal origin. Fibrosarcomas appear to be sporadic, but cases of fibrosarcomas secondary to radiation of nasopharyngeal carcinomas have been reported. Paranasal sinus fibrosarcomas (PNFS) are even rarer with few cases being reported since the 1950s. There have been several retrospective cohort studies examining PNFS; however, to our knowledge, no comprehensive review exists. This review aims to summarize the findings of all published cases of PNFS from the 1950s to the 2020s. We hope that a comprehensive review will assist in accurate and early diagnoses of PNFS, and help guide treatment as early treatment is associated with a favorable prognosis.This systematic review reports results following the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ines. A search was conducted on PubMed, Embase, and Cochrane Library. Studies were screened using established inclusion/exclusion criteria. A total of 26 studies were included for data extraction, and relevant data were collected and analyzed.In our study, the most common study type was case reports (n = 19). The most common presentation for PNFS included male gender (n = 17) with maxillary sinus (n = 57) involvement. Patients commonly presented with complaints of nasal obstruction (n = 15), epistaxis (n = 11), and facial fullness/pain (n = 9). Surgical resection was the mainstay treatment, with the use of chemotherapy or radiation depending on surgical margins and resectability. The diagnosis was commonly made with histological analysis. This review of the literature provides a summary and reference of important presenting factors, elements of diagnosis, and treatment options regarding PNFS to help bring awareness and guide the treatment of such a rare disease. Moving forward, there is a greater need for larger standardized studies that can further complement our findings, as well as more consistent reporting of cases

    Academic Benchmarks for Otolaryngology Leaders

    This study aimed to characterize current benchmarks for academic otolaryngologists serving in positions of leadership and identify factors potentially associated with promotion to these positions. Information regarding chairs (or division chiefs), vice chairs, and residency program directors was obtained from faculty listings and organized by degree(s) obtained, academic rank, fellowship training status, sex, and experience. Research productivity was characterized by (a) successful procurement of active grants from the National Institutes of Health and prior grants from the American Academy of Otolaryngology-Head and Neck Surgery Foundation Centralized Otolaryngology Research Efforts program and (b) scholarly impact, as measured by the h-index. Chairs had the greatest amount of experience (32.4 years) and were the least likely to have multiple degrees, with 75.8% having an MD degree only. Program directors were the most likely to be fellowship trained (84.8%). Women represented 16% of program directors, 3% of chairs, and no vice chairs. Chairs had the highest scholarly impact (as measured by the h-index) and the greatest external grant funding. This analysis characterizes the current picture of leadership in academic otolaryngology. Chairs, when compared to their vice chair and program director counterparts, had more experience and greater research impact. Women were poorly represented among all academic leadership positions

    Image-guidance in endoscopic sinus surgery: is it associated with decreased medicolegal liability?

    BackgroundThe use of image-guidance (IG) in endoscopic sinus surgery (ESS) has escalated over the last decade despite a lack of consensus that its use improves outcomes or decreases complications. One theoretical reason for using IG in ESS is its potential to minimize legal liability should an adverse outcome occur. In this study, we aimed to characterize the role of IG in ESS litigation, and further detail other factors in pertinent cases. A secondary objective was to characterize recent malpractice litigation for other relevant factors. MethodsRelevant cases from Westlaw were examined to determine whether the use of IG played a role in initiating litigation in ESS malpractice suits. Factors such as patient demographics and alleged cause(s) of malpractice litigation were examined. ResultsOut of 30 malpractice cases from 2004 to April 2013, 4 (13.3%) mentioned the use of IG during ESS, although this did not appear to be a factor affecting the plaintiff's decision to initiate litigation, nor the case outcomes. In the 26 cases (86.7%) in which IG was not used, its non-use was not specified as an alleged cause of negligence. Eleven (36.7%) cases were resolved in the defendant's favor. Frequently-cited factors included iatrogenic injury (83.3%), permanent deficits (66.7%), needing additional surgery (63.3%), orbital and intracranial injury, and perceived deficits in informed consent (40.0%). ConclusionThe use of IG was not found to be a factor in ESS litigation. This suggests that not using IG does not necessarily make one more vulnerable to malpractice litigation

    Modified Subtotal Lothrop Procedure for Extended Frontal Sinus and Anterior Skull Base Access: A Cadaveric Feasibility Study with Clinical Correlates

    Objective The endoscopic modified Lothrop procedure (EMLP) is an established approach for recalcitrant frontal sinus disease and anterior skull base exposure. However, in select cases, this technique may involve unnecessary resection of sinonasal structures. In this study, we propose a modification of the EMLP, termed the modified subtotal-Lothrop procedure (MSLP), to access the anterior skull base and complex frontal sinus disease for which access to the bilateral frontal sinus posterior table is required. Methods A cadaveric dissection with photo documentation was performed at an academic medical center on four cadaver heads using standard endoscopic techniques to demonstrate the MSLP and its feasibility. Results The endoscopic MSLP allowed ample access for instrumentation in each of the dissections using a 30- or 70-degree endoscope. Adequate bilateral access to the posterior table of the frontal sinus was gained in all cases without the need for dissection of the contralateral frontal sinus recess (FSR). Conclusion The MSLP appears to be a feasible technique for exposure of the anterior skull base and accessing complex frontal sinus pathology. This modification provides similar anterior skull base exposure and surgical maneuverability as the EMLP while limiting surgical dissection to one FSR, thereby preserving as much of the natural mucociliary drainage pathways as possible
